Hafnium(IV) N-Butoxide, with the chemical formula Hf(OC4H9)4, is a moisture-sensitive, clear pale yellow liquid primarily used in electronics, chemical engineering, and research applications. Also known by synonyms such as n-Butoxy hafniumTetrabutoxyhafnium(IV), and 1-Butanol, hafnium salt (4:1), this compound plays a significant role in advanced material processing, particularly in deposition processes like ALD (Atomic Layer Deposition). It is identified by CAS number 22411-22-9. Its functionality and performance attributes make it indispensable in fields requiring high purity and thermal stability.

Market Dynamics (Drivers, Restraints, Opportunities, and Challenges)

Drivers:

Growing Demand in Electronics: With widespread adoption in semiconductor manufacturing, Hafnium(IV) N-Butoxide is a preferred precursor for thin-film deposition.

Rising R&D Expenditures: Universities, research institutes, and corporate R&D units are expanding experiments with metal alkoxides, boosting consumption.

High Thermal and Chemical Stability: These attributes make the compound ideal for demanding applications requiring precision and durability.

Restraints:

Moisture Sensitivity: The compound's reactivity with moisture demands stringent storage and handling procedures, increasing overall operational costs.

Limited Supplier Base: With few global manufacturers, price volatility and supply chain dependency are concerns.

Opportunities:

Emerging Nanotechnology Applications: Hafnium(IV) N-Butoxide holds promise in next-generation material synthesis at the nanoscale.

Expansion in APAC and MEA: Industrial development and technological advancements in these regions can open new revenue streams.

Challenges:

Stringent Regulations: Compliance with chemical safety and environmental guidelines can be time-consuming and expensive.

Technical Barriers: High purity synthesis requires complex procedures that not all manufacturers can achieve consistently.
